Bhubaneswar, May 20: Odisha recorded 21.07 percent voting in the voter turnout trend till 11 am in the second phase of polling for five Lok Sabha seats and 35 Assembly constituencies in the state, according to the data released by the Election Commission of India.

Jharsuguda witnessed the highest voting, the lowest number of votes was cast in Bolangir. According to the state election officials, the maximum voter turnout was 25.32% in Jharsuguda, while the lowest voter turnout (17.16%) was recorded in Bolangir.

Similarly, 22.06% of votes were cast in Bargarh, 21.75% in Boudh, 21.98% in Ganjam, 19.35% in Kandhamal.
